Gard(e)nat, Gardnett, n. [Var. of Gard(e)nap,n., perhaps after F. natte, mat.] = Gard(e)nap. — 1490 Acts Lords of Council 131/1.
A butter plait, a gardenat
1546 Ib. (MS) XXI. 55 b.
Twa gardnatis of bras
1561 Aberdeen B. Rec. I. 336.
Ane gardnett of tun [= tin]
1573 Ib. II. 10.
A gardnet of bras
